We're excited to share two post-doc research fellowships that are available
to work with Information Systems researchers from the University of
Virginia McIntire School of Commerce. Both are two-year positions based in
Charlottesville, Virginia. These positions will sponsor applicants for work
visas.


The first open position is to work directly with Brent Kitchens and
collaborators on the impacts of misinformation and other aspects of online
information quality on mental health and other outcomes for young adults. (

   -

   Flexible starting date, with target of summer of 2025
   -

   Project funded by the Thriving Youth in Digital Environment grand
   challenge
   -

   Will have an opportunity for regular interaction with other IT scholars
   in the area, another post-doc fellow working on a closely related project,
   and other post-docs across campus.
   -

   Position will include access to large-scale behavioral clickstream and
   search data for observational analysis:

The second open position is to work on a self-identified project at the
intersection of DT and Democracy with mentorship by Steven L. Johnson
and/or other lab leads. Projects can encompass a wide range of topics,
methods, and disciplines. (

   -

   Start date in August, 2025
   -

   Project funded by the Digital Technology and Democracy grand challenge
   -

   Will join a cohort of post-doc fellow working in the DT & Democracy lab,
   including six who started in August, 2024 and a second cohort starting in
   August, 2025.
   -

   Application deadline is January 15, 2025, with an expectation of final
   decisions made by March 1st, 2025.
   -

   Contact Steven L. Johnson (steven at virginia.edu) to help answer
   questions, including about how many IT-related research questions are
   relevant to the understanding of Digital Technology and Democracy.

Both opportunities are appropriate for scholars in IS, communications, and
many other disciplines that investigate the impacts of digital technology.
